The size of Auchenflower is approximately 1.5 square kilometres. There are 8 parks, covering nearly 5.6% of the total area. The population of Auchenflower in 2016 was 5870 people. By 2021 the population was 6053 showing a population growth of 3.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Auchenflower is 20-29 years. Households in Auchenflower are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Auchenflower work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 51.80% of the homes in Auchenflower were owner-occupied compared with 48.30% in 2016.
